Three to five dreams per night are common. Dreams can last several minutes. We rarely remember night dreams when we get out of bed. Some remain in the memory for a long time. What should be their interpretation? The meaning of dreams is often associated with current circumstances and lucid wishes and fears.

Modern psychology has a lot to offer in the area of dream interpretation. Sigmund Freud and Carl Gustav Jung have already turned their attention to them. Freud believed that dreams are the result of conflicts with which we struggle in everyday life, while Jung argued that their interpretation is the key to the human soul, and the dreams themselves are a symbol of deeply hidden desires.

Psychological approach to dream interpretation
Since ancient times, dreams have fascinated man. They were credited with magical powers and believed that they play a large role. Then the first dream books appeared, on the basis of which attempts were made to find out the meaning of dreams. The interpretation was based on the detection of duplicate characters. Many of them have the same meanings in dream books from different cultures. Today's majority of people don't pay attention to their dreams. They do not use dream books to find the meaning.

The psychology of dreams has been and continues to attribute great importance to them, and takes them very seriously. This is largely due to Freud, who included his thoughts in the famous work "Introduction to Psychoanalysis". His interpretation of dreams was rather superficial, he associated all dreams with problems of a sexual nature. The student Jung also dealt with the problem of dreams, but his approach was completely different. Jung believed that dreams were a type of pointer that indicated the best course of action. He also noticed the presence of certain symbols that are repeated in the fantasies of many people, regardless of age and culture.



What are the foundations of dream interpretation?
If we really want to interpret dreams, we must relate them to the situation in which we are now. A general online dream book may not give us comprehensive information. Different symbols may mean different things depending on what they are usually associated with. The interpretation of dreams should be based on knowledge of emotions and experiences. The context is also very important. It is important to think outside the box and see your dreams from a different perspective.

The meaning of dreams and their analysis
The interpretation of dreams can help us understand our fears and desires better. The interpretation of one dream is not enough to reveal all the secrets. Unfortunately, this raises a problem - how do we remember fantasies? Start with a journal in which you will regularly record your dreams. The description does not need to be detailed, but it is important that it contains the main message and information about key characters or events. You can keep a notebook near your bed to record the passages you have memorized.

We will soon notice that our dreams are becoming more vivid and we can recall more of them so that we can understand their meaning. Interpretation should begin by identifying recurring elements and those that grab our attention. In the next step, we check what emotions are awakening in our dreams and what they mean to us.

The context should extend to past or present events and experiences. It's also worthwhile to write down your findings and return them within a few days.
